Syniverse's Universal Commerce Again Earns Top Honors in Juniper Research's Future Digital Awards

Platform empowers organizations across industries to benefit from blockchain-powered clearing and settlement processes

TAMPA, Fla.--(BUSINESS WIRE)--Syniverse, the world's most connected company®, has earned a Platinum Award for Billing and Charging Evolution Platform Innovation and a Gold Award for Data and Financial Clearing Solution Innovation in Juniper Research's annual Future Digital Awards for Telco Innovation.

Syniverse's Universal Commerce platform was recognized in both categories a year after it won a Platinum Award as the Best Billing and Charging Evolution (BCE) Platform. Universal Commerce helps mobile network operators (MNOs) maximize their roaming business potential through streamlined and standardized clearing and settlement processes. It also addresses the growing complexity of billing and payment exchanges between home and visited MNOs.

The Future Digital Awards for Telco Innovation spotlight companies that demonstrate significant contributions to their sectors and show strong potential for future market impact. In the past year, Universal Commerce expanded beyond traditional telecommunications to serve satellite providers, Internet of Things (IoT) companies, and organizations in other industries requiring complex ecosystem settlement.

"Universal Commerce's application in these new use cases exemplifies how Syniverse approaches innovation — by developing solutions that address today's challenges and tomorrow's opportunities," said Nathan Robbins, VP of Strategy and Alliance at Syniverse. "As business needs change, we'll continue creating flexible solutions that serve various purposes and requirements."

Universal Commerce encrypts each transaction using blockchain technology and provides security through a private, decentralized ledger. Its smart contracts allow businesses to establish partnerships and begin exchanging traffic in as little as 15 minutes, while its wholesale aggregation capabilities enable organizations to process and monetize vast amounts of small, bursty transmissions from IoT devices.

Syniverse has deployed Universal Commerce for 90% of BCE-compliant international mobile operators and processes 50 billion BCE records annually. The platform's success stems from its strong network effect: As additional carriers join, more direct settlements occur, increasing Universal Commerce's value for all participants.
